Transaction efcf8fee76a513be46213160b41e9df144b75064a30fa4aec13ca35783c6aed7

1 Input
2 Outputs
  • efcf8fee76a513be46213160b41e9df144b75064a30fa4aec13ca35783c6aed7:0
  • value  3169724
    address  36kmXHix9Hpx1jrsyVFGiboe2s5VxTBsb1
  • efcf8fee76a513be46213160b41e9df144b75064a30fa4aec13ca35783c6aed7:1
  • value  1658070
    address  33A49BB7Z3PHStJVgf71DaFyfJjVK5zavW